A desiccator is a special container that has two ‘layers’ separated by a wire gauze; this allows different substances to be placed in it without mixing the two while still allowing them to ‘interact’ since they are both equally exposed to the air that circulates within this container. The appearance of blue colour near the iron nail indicates the presence of iron(II) ions, while the appearance of pink colour indicates the presence of hydroxide ions. If the nail is coupled with a more electro-positive metal like zinc, magnesium or aluminium, rusting is prevented but on the other hand, if it is coupled with less electro-positive metals like copper, the rusting is facilitated. Now, if you put a nail in a beaker, add enough water to completely cover the nail, and then add enough oil to completely cover the surface of the water, there won't be enough oxygen dissolved in the water to rust the nail more than a little bit. Methods used to prevent Rusting of Iron are as follows: Alloying – Since Rusting of Iron is a chemical process that happens because the metal is attaining more stable chemical state, alloying (mixing) the iron with other stable metals or alloys can slow down the process of rusting.
